常用的云主机传输工具有以下几种:
1、SCP(Secure Copy):SCP是一种基于SSH协议的安全文件传输工具,可以在本地和远程主机之间进行文件的复制、移动和删除操作,它使用加密通道来保护数据传输的安全性。
2、SFTP(Secure File Transfer Protocol):SFTP也是一种基于SSH协议的文件传输工具,与SCP类似,但它不仅支持文件的复制、移动和删除操作,还支持文件的创建、重命名和修改等操作。
3、Rsync:Rsync是一种高效的文件同步工具,它可以将本地文件或目录同步到远程主机,或者将远程主机的文件或目录同步到本地,Rsync支持增量传输,只传输发生变化的文件部分,从而提高了传输效率。
4、FTP(File Transfer Protocol):FTP是一种常见的文件传输协议,可以使用FTP客户端和服务器进行文件的上传和下载操作,FTP协议本身并不安全,因此在传输敏感数据时需要使用加密的FTP连接,如FTP over TLS(FTPS)。
5、SMB/CIFS(Server Message Block/Common Internet File System):SMB/CIFS是一种用于在局域网中共享文件和打印机的协议,通过SMB/CIFS,可以在Windows主机和Linux主机之间进行文件的传输和共享。
6、NFS(Network File System):NFS是一种用于在UNIX和Linux系统之间共享文件的网络协议,通过NFS,可以将远程主机上的目录挂载到本地主机上,从而实现对远程文件的访问和管理。
7、HTTP(Hypertext Transfer Protocol):HTTP是一种用于在Web浏览器和Web服务器之间传输数据的协议,虽然HTTP主要用于网页的传输,但也可以用于传输其他类型的数据,如文件。
8、RESTful API:RESTful API是一种基于HTTP协议的接口设计风格,可以用于在不同的系统之间进行数据的传输和交互,通过RESTful API,可以实现对云主机上的资源进行增删改查等操作。
9、WebDAV(Webbased Distributed Authoring and Versioning):WebDAV是一种扩展HTTP协议的功能,用于在Web服务器和客户端之间进行分布式的创作、版本控制和协作,通过WebDAV,可以在云主机上进行文件的上传、下载、复制和移动等操作。
10、MQTT(Message Queuing Telemetry Transport):MQTT是一种轻量级的发布/订阅消息传输协议,适用于低带宽、不稳定网络环境下的数据传输,通过MQTT,可以在云主机之间进行实时的消息传递和通信。
以下是两个与本文相关的问题及解答:
问题1:如何选择合适的云主机传输工具?
答:选择合适的云主机传输工具需要考虑以下几个因素:根据数据传输的需求确定所需的功能,如文件的复制、移动、删除、创建、重命名和修改等;考虑数据传输的安全性要求,选择支持加密传输的工具;再次,考虑网络环境和性能要求,选择适合当前网络环境的工具;根据个人或团队的使用习惯和熟悉程度选择合适的工具。
问题2:在使用云主机传输工具时需要注意哪些安全问题?
答:在使用云主机传输工具时需要注意以下安全问题:确保使用加密传输协议,如SCP over SSH、SFTP over SSH、FTP over TLS等;使用强密码来保护登录凭证的安全;再次,限制访问权限,只允许有权限的用户进行文件传输操作;定期更新和升级工具软件以修复已知的安全漏洞;监控和记录文件传输活动,及时发现异常行为并采取相应的安全措施。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/464989.html